Just want to get some advice about the performance of these bullets from people with first hand experience using them on elephants

I could not find a lot of reports on their use on Elephants ,I know they penetrate well in test mediums,but they do have a design feature that makes them deform/expand a bit to achieve stability and deeper penetration

In a article by Pierre van der Walt he does mention that they penetrate less in a dry medium and on Elephant sculls than conventional bullets but sufficiently so if driven above 2200FPS

Apparently they shine with body shots where the tissue density is different than in a elephant scull(Honeycomb)

I've been loading 450gr FN Solids to about 2100fps in my 450NE (Yes they regulate reasonable well)

Will that be reliable enough for a frontal brain shot?

So the North Fork Cup Point Solid is a similar design in that it purposely expands in a relatively limited fashion. In talking to the North Fork folks they recommend the Flat Point solid on elephant, not the Cup Point. It comes down to penetration I believe, and especially after hitting a really hard bone like a hip if need be. I ended up using the flat point based on this advice, but the cup would be a great choice for buffalo, and likely "ok" for elephant. On elephant though, most people want more than "ok.'
